Hand-Painted Canvas Panels

Start with simple canvas panels in white or cream, and use acrylic paints to create abstract shapes, minimalist landscapes, or tiny motifs that match your existing color palette. These pieces can be made in a single afternoon and hung in clusters for a relaxed, artful vibe.

Curated Photo Displays with Clipboards

Clipboards hung on a narrow ledge or wall rod offer a flexible way to rotate photos, notes, and sketches. This approach fits neatly into cute diy decor ideas because it is low commitment and easy to refresh whenever you want a new arrangement.
Combine vintage clips with printed snapshots, postcards, or fabric swatches to add depth and personality. In a kitchen, office, or entryway, this display stays practical while giving the room a warm, lived-in character.

Macramé Plant Hangers and Wall Hangings
Macramé adds graceful lines and a handcrafted look that suits both modern and rustic interiors. A plant hanger made with simple knots can become a statement piece while maximizing vertical space in corners or near windows.
As part of your cute diy decor ideas, these hangers introduce organic shapes and gentle movement, making a room feel more relaxed and alive. You can experiment with different cord thicknesses and wooden rings to match your personal aesthetic.

Modular Shelf Units from Simple Materials
Stackable crates, wooden boards, or even repurposed books can be transformed into modular shelves that adapt to any wall or corner. This flexible approach allows you to adjust your storage as your collection grows or your style changes.
